Windsor, ND is situated in rural North Dakota and is known for its quiet, small-town charm. Despite the town's relative seclusion, it offers a wide range of health services to its citizens. In fact, Windsor has access to several nearby hospitals and medical facilities that provide essential care and treatment options to local patients. These include places such as St Joseph's Hospital and the Altru Family Medicine Windor clinic. The town also benefits from the presence of other health-care providers such as chiropractors, dentists, physical therapists, counselors, home health aides and occupational therapists. All these options ensure that residents have access to comprehensive care services no matter what their health needs may be.
